Abstract

The frequency generator includes a programmable memory (MR) addressed using a coded combination (CE). An oscillator (OS) provides control pulses (ic). A frist division chain includes a programmable divider (DP1) controlled by the control pulses, which receives the coded combinations (CS) stored in the memory (MR) at the address defined by the coded combination (CE). The division chain also includes a fixed diviser (DS1) whose input is connected to the output of the programmable diviser, and a function generator circuit (GF1) whose input is connected to the diviser output (DS1). A second division chain is provided identical to the first ending in a second function generator circuit (GF2) which like the first is connected to a mixer (ML). An amplifying and filtering circuit (AF) receives the mixer output and provides the final output signal (af).
